Hankook Continues Support of DAV With $175,000 Donation

Aug. 8, 2019

Hankook Tire America Corp. has renewed its commitment to DAV (Disabled American Veterans), which provides free services to veterans of all generations where they live.

In the fifth year of its partnership with DAV, Hankook is donating $175,000 to help veterans and their families nationwide by providing access to employment resources and Veteran Affairs benefits by sponsoring career fairs and DAV's Mobile Service Office (MSO) program.

The 2019 partnership was announced at DAV's 98th National Convention on Saturday, Aug. 3, in Orlando, Fla. During the convention's opening ceremony, Rob Williams, Hankook’s senior director of TBR tires, presented the check to DAV National Adjutant and CEO Marc Burgess and National Commander Dennis Nixon.

Hankook Drives Job Opportunities with DAV Career Fairs

This year, Hankook is sponsoring six DAV career fairs throughout the country. The career fairs aim to bring opportunities to veterans, their spouses, active-duty personnel and members of the National Guard and Reserve in their local communities from companies seeking the unique traits, dedication and commitment they gain from their military service.

As part of this support, Hankook will recruit employees for its Clarksville, Tenn., plant and Nashville, Tenn., headquarters during the DAV career fair in Nashville on Sept. 5, at the Nissan Stadium in Nashville.

DAV and Hankook Support Veterans Through Mobility

Through DAV's MSO program, DAV National Service Officers drive their "office on wheels" across the country to counsel and assist veterans, educating them and their families on the benefits and services earned in service. This program extends DAV's benefits assistance to veterans who might not be able to access it otherwise due to distance, transportation, health or other various reasons. Hankook continues its promise to help American veterans through mobility with 12 Hankook-sponsored DAV MSO stops this year. To bring DAV's claims specialists to veterans in their local communities on a national scale, Hankook partners with tire dealers and distributors across the country.

In addition, as a continuation of the 2018 partnership, Hankook recently donated a new DAV Transportation Network vehicle to help Nashville area veterans access the healthcare they earned in service to our nation. The Hankook-branded vehicle is now the only vehicle permanently stationed at Hankook's hometown Nashville Campus of the Tennessee Valley Healthcare System. Without the volunteer-driven vehicle providing free, reliable transportation, many ill and injured veterans wouldn't receive critical health services.
